1. Getting Started

The A1 Certificate streamlines international work arrangements, offering an efficient and legally sound solution for businesses and employees that operate across borders. The certificate ensures that workers are not governed by the social security laws of more than one country, preventing overpayments and administrative burdens. It is a legal requirement for anyone who is posted to an EU country. It is a possibility for employees who travel to other countries for business, for example, to attend meetings, conferences or fairs.

The steps to obtain an A1 certificate could differ between countries however the basic steps are the identical. Employees must first check their eligibility, and then complete the appropriate form with the competent authority. This will include information about their home country, employer and the countries they'll be working in. In the majority of cases, it is best to fill out this form online. Then, employees must submit the form along with the relevant documents to their home country's social security authorities.

Once an A1 certificate has been issued, it is valid for a year and is valid in any European Union country. 2. Documentation

The A1 certificate is a key piece of documentation required for workers who travel frequently to various countries for work. The certificate shows that the worker is insured in his or her home country. This allows them to avoid paying for social insurance premiums in other countries. This could save businesses lots of money in the long run. However, it's essential for employers to be aware of the documents required by their employees to fill out this form.

To avoid penalties and fines, employees who travel abroad for business must have an A1 certificate that is valid. This is especially important for project workers who may be required to show the certificate when registering in hotels or attending conferences. It's also important to stay current with the latest A1 certificate rules and regulations, because there have been recent changes that could affect how this process works.

The primary goal of an A1 certificate is preventing social dumping. This happens when workers from a member state of the EU is transferred to another state without being covered by the social security system in their home country. The A1 certificate guards against this by proving that the worker is covered in his or her home country. Civil servants, employees, and self-employed people must get an A1 certificate when they're sent to another EU member state, or Iceland, Norway, Liechtenstein, or Switzerland for work-related reasons.

A1 certificates are typically issued by the statutory health insurance company for the person in question. The form is essentially a letter that includes information like the name of the person and address. It also contains a special field that lists the country to which the individual plans to work and a description of the nature of the work to be carried out there.
